Output dd71d2883a98428d161f7c442b24b332bcb74b51dd94f73b26f368196e5dbbe5:0

value
491646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 640973c885136d26b48cf1c28bbdbd5fdf771caf OP_EQUAL
address
3AoxpUwmj8T1Q2nCYJvKnfjQeQcnkhqQRg
transaction
dd71d2883a98428d161f7c442b24b332bcb74b51dd94f73b26f368196e5dbbe5
spent
true